Official sales channels and major retailers

The most reliable, though often more expensive, way to buy is to contact the brand’s official partners. Large electronics chains buy batches of equipment legally, providing a full local warranty. This means that in the case of a factory marriage, you can rent the device to a service center at your place of residence without sending it abroad. Large retailers value their reputation, so the risk of running into a fake or a restored device is minimal.

The advantage of buying from large stores is that you can feel the product before you pay. You can come to the salon, ask the consultant to show you a showcase sample of Xiaomi 14, evaluate the ergonomics and build quality. In addition, many networks offer trade-in programs that allow you to rent an old smartphone for the purchase of a new one, which can significantly reduce the final cost.

But you have to consider that offline retail margins often include rent, staff salaries and logistics, so the shelf price tag can be much higher than online stores, and if you're willing to overpay for peace of mind and instant delivery, this is the best option for you.

⚠️ Note: In official stores, the gray (Chinese) versions can be sold without a Russian box and with a charging plug that does not meet our standards.

Purchase through marketplaces: Wildberries, Ozon, Yandex.Market

Marketplaces have become the primary marketplace for electronics, offering a wide range of sellers and often lower prices. Here, it is important to distinguish between goods labeled as "from the seller Ozon/WB" (platform warehouse) and goods from third-party suppliers. In the first case, logistics and returns are controlled by the marketplace itself, which increases the reliability of the transaction. In the second case, you actually buy from a small business, and the risks may be higher.

The main advantage of such sites is the ability to quickly compare the offers of dozens of stores. You can sort the list by price, seller's rating or delivery time. Often Xiaomi 14 has coupons and discounts that reduce the price below the recommended retail. In addition, many sellers on marketplaces have already brought the goods to Russia, and delivery takes 1-3 days.

When choosing a seller, pay attention to the number of reviews and the percentage of positive ratings. If the store is recent or has many complaints about marriage, it is better to refrain from buying. Also check if the product card indicates that it is Global or Chinese (CN). Chinese versions are often cheaper, but may have problems with notifications and language.

Comparison of prices and guarantees

Pricing on Xiaomi 14 is highly dependent on the exchange rate and the way the goods are imported. Official dealers fix the price in rubles, taking into account all taxes, while sellers on marketplaces and in small stores can quickly change the price tags depending on the current exchange. Below is a table showing the approximate distribution of cost and conditions in different types of stores.

Type of sellerAverage priceGuaranteeTime of delivery
Official retailerTall.1 year (RF)Available
Marketplace (Russian Warehouse)Medium1 year (from seller)1-3 days
Online shopping (CIS)Low/Mediocre1 year (international)5-10 days
Delivery from ChinaMinimumNo. 14 days.2-4 weeks

It's worth noting that a "store warranty" in small locations often means that if you break down, you'll have to carry the device to an authorized service, and the store will only act as an intermediary. In official networks, the seller takes over the process completely. If the price difference is small, you'd better choose an option with more transparent warranty obligations.

Also keep in mind that when buying a gray product (parallel imports), the warranty may be international, but to activate it will require a check issued in the importing country (for example, in Kazakhstan or the UAE).

Order from abroad: AliExpress, Poizon and other sites

For those who are willing to wait and want to save money, there is a foreign option, and Chinese sites like AliExpress or specialty stores like TradingShenzhen often offer Xiaomi 14s at prices close to those recommended in China, but there are different rules of the game and risks.

The main difficulty is customs. When ordering goods more than 200 euros (the limit may vary, follow the current news of the FCS), you will have to pay a fee of 15% of the excess amount. This can negate all savings. In addition, delivery can take from two weeks to one and a half months, and the tracking number sometimes stops updating for a long time.

The Chinese version (CN Version) has its own peculiarities: Chinese and English are pre-installed, but no Russian (although it can be added manually or reflashed), and some LTE frequencies used by Russian operators may be missing, which will lead to a weaker signal in some regions.

⚠️ Note: When ordering from China, you will most likely have to search for an adapter for the socket yourself or buy a charger separately, as the plug will be Chinese or American.

Buying through intermediaries is another option: They take the goods in China and send them to you, already paying the fees. It is more expensive than direct ordering, but safer and faster. Proven buyers often have their own Telegram channels or social media groups.

How to distinguish the original from a fake or refurbished device

The electronics market is saturated not only with original devices, but also with copies or refurbished devices that are sold as new. Xiaomi 14 is a complex smartphone, and making an exact replica of it is difficult, but scammers can sell older models under the guise of new products or devices with replaced components.

The first thing to notice is the packaging. The original Xiaomi box always has high-quality printing, clear fonts and sits tightly on the device. At the bottom of the box, a sticker with IMEI, serial number and model should be pasted, these data should match the ones listed in the system (you can check *#06# on the call keyboard).

The second important step is to check through the official website, go to the Xiaomi authentication page and enter the serial number, the system will confirm whether such a device exists and when it was activated, if the device is allegedly activated six months ago, and you buy it as a new one, this is a restored instance or used one.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Is there a difference between Xiaomi 14 and Xiaomi 14 Pro when buying?
The Pro version has a larger screen, a larger battery and an improved telephoto lens, but it's much larger. Make sure you buy the model you wanted, because the names on the product cards are often shortened.
Will NFC and Google Pay work on the Chinese version?
NFC will work for file transfer and tag reading. However, contactless payment by Mir Pay or other services on Chinese firmware may not work or require complex manipulation of regions.
Can I download the Chinese version of Xiaomi 14 for the global version?
Technically, this is possible, but the procedure requires unlocking the bootloader, which in new Xiaomi models can be a paid and complicated process. In addition, when you flash it, you can lose the warranty and get a brick if you make a mistake.
What is the Xiaomi 14 in the box?
In the box is the smartphone itself, a protective case, a USB-C cable and a quick charging unit of 90 W. Separately buy anything you do not need, everything you need to start is already included in the price.
